Tooth Caries: Tooth Caries or Decay, also known as cavities on tooth, is the most common disease which i had seen in my daily practice. Tooth decay occurs when plaque, the sticky substance that forms on teeth. The sugars and/or starches of the food we eat with the help of microorganism, this combination produces forms acids that attack tooth enamel causes Tooth Caries. The most common bacteria associated with dental Caries are the mutans streptococci & other Streptococcus mutans and Streptococcus sobrinus, and lactobacilli.

Bad Breath: Bad breath, also called Halitosis, can be socially very embarrassing. According to dental studies, about 85 percent of people with persistent bad breath have a dental problem.
Gum disease, Caries,Ulcer, Oral Cancer, dry mouth, and bacteria on the tongue are some of the dental problems that can cause bad breath. Using mouthwash to cover up bad breath & solve your dental problem.

Bad breath can also be because of disease of nose and throat or food habit or some medicine. Other cause can be for some cancers, and conditions such as metabolic disorders, can cause a distinctive breath odor as a result of chemicals they produce. Chronic reflux of stomach acids (gastroesophageal reflux disease, or GERD) can be associated with bad breath.


 Gum Problem, Bleeding Gum or Gingivitis & Periodontist: Gum disease, also known as Gingivitis & Periodontist, is an infection of the gums that surrounding the teeth. Dental plaque & Calculus causes Gum problem. It is also one of the main causes of Bleeding gum & tooth loss among adults. The symptoms include bad breath, red, swollen, bleeding gums,tender, sensitive teeth, painful chewing & loss teeth. There are two major stages of gum disease: Gingivitis and Periodontitis.Poor oral hygiene causes gum disease. Every 6month visit Dentist for scaling treatment,for prevention of gum problem.

  Tooth Attrition, Erosion, Abrasion: 

Tooth attrition commonly seen because of trauma to tooth, tooth malocclusion,tooth grinding or bruxism. Tooth Attrition, Erosion, Abrasion can also causes for hard brush,wrong tooth paste or chemical, microorganism. Tooth Attrition, Erosion, Abrasion initially causes tooth sensitivity later can cause teeth pain. Visit Dentist if you are facing this problem. Charcoal can cause tooth abrasion or erosion, don't use this to clean tooth.

  Mouth Ulcer: Acute ulcer usually harmless but they’re a real pain and can make eating, and even speaking, a painful or uncomfortable experience. More often than not an ulcer is caused by damage to the mouth. For example if you accidentally bite,malocclusion or any trauma. Stress ulcer is commonly seen for any mental stress. Vitamin deficiency also can cause ulcer. If ulcer is for long time,Chronic then don't neglect, it can be Cancer.

Oral Cancer:  Oral cancer is a serious and deadly disease that affects millions of people. It is often curable if diagnosed and treated in the early stages. At early stages, it can be unnoticed. It can be painless with slight physical changes. But the precursor tissue changes, can be noticed by the doctors. Tobacco can cause cancer. Risk factors is Alcohol,Human papillomavirus, Ultraviolet exposure on the lips, genetic.

Prevention:
  • Stick to gentle, twice-daily brushing with a soft/medium bristle or electric brush 
  • Use proper tooth brush & tooth paste. Don't use Charcoal this to clean tooth.
  • Clean your tongue with tongue cleaner.
  • Rinse water  after every food with sometime use Chlorhexidine mouthwash.
  • Floss once daily & you can massage gum with your finger.
  • Chewing habit of hard & fibrous food is a good habit, don't take always soft or liquid food.
  • Clean nicely after taking smelly food like onion, ginger, egg,meat etc. 
  • Take balanced diet & vegetables. proper nutrition needed.
  • Avoid Tobacco, Alcohol
  • If you are having malocclusion then get the treatment.For bruxism Night guard you can use.
  • Also be sure to schedule regular dentist visits for plaque and tartar removal. Every 6 month visit Dentist for scaling treatment,for prevention of dental & general health problems.
